In which application are binary trees particularly useful for searching data?

Practice Questions

Q1
In which application are binary trees particularly useful for searching data?
  1. Database indexing
  2. Image processing
  3. Network routing
  4. File storage

Questions & Step-by-Step Solutions

In which application are binary trees particularly useful for searching data?
  • Step 1: Understand what a binary tree is. A binary tree is a data structure where each node has at most two children, referred to as the left child and the right child.
  • Step 2: Learn about searching data. Searching data means looking for a specific piece of information within a collection of data.
  • Step 3: Know that binary trees can be organized in a way that makes searching faster. This is done by arranging the nodes so that for any given node, all values in the left subtree are smaller and all values in the right subtree are larger.
  • Step 4: Recognize that binary trees are particularly useful in applications like database indexing. Database indexing is a method used to quickly locate and access data in a database.
  • Step 5: Understand that using binary trees in database indexing allows for efficient searching, insertion, and deletion of records, making it easier to manage large amounts of data.
No concepts available.
Soulshift Feedback ×

On a scale of 0–10, how likely are you to recommend The Soulshift Academy?

Not likely Very likely